I've been using Prochem All Fiber Deep Rinse, Liquid Slurry and lately Chemeister's Action Extraction.
I'm not sure I notice any difference in the cleaning result, all of them seem to do a good job except that the Chemeister seems to leave the carpets softer feeling and without any slick film on the fibers.
I guess most of the cleaning action comes from the pre spray but are there any rinses that stand out for adding more cleaning power or are they pretty much interchangeable?
